Information Technology Reference
In-Depth Information
29. J. Knoop, B. Steen, and J. Vollmer. Parallelism for free: Bitvector analyses
! No state explosion! In Proceedings of the 1st International Workshop on
Tools and Algorithms for the Construction and Analysis of Systems ( TACAS'95 )
( Aarhus, Denmark ), Lecture Notes in Computer Science, vol. 1019, pages 264 {
289. Springer-Verlag, Heidelberg, Germany, 1995.
30. J. Knoop, B. Steen, and J. Vollmer. Parallelism for free: Ecient and optimal
bitvector analyses for parallel programs. ACM Transactions on Programming Lan-
guages and Systems , 18(3):268 { 299, 1996.
31. K. Marriot. Frameworks for abstract interpretation. Acta Informatica , 30:103 {
129, 1993.
32. E. Morel and C. Renvoise. Global optimization by suppression of partial redun-
dancies. Communications of the ACM , 22(2):96 { 103, 1979.
33. E. Morel and C. Renvoise. Interprocedural elimination of partial redundancies.
In S. S. Muchnick and N. D. Jones, editors, Program Flow Analysis: Theory and
Applications , chapter 7, pages 160 { 188. Prentice Hall, Englewood Clis, New
Jersey, 1981.
34. R. Morgan. Building an Optimizing Compiler . Digital Press, 1998.
35. S. S. Muchnick. Advanced Compiler Design and Implementation . Morgan Kauf-
mann, San Francisco, California, 1997.
36. S. S. Muchnick and N. D. Jones, editors. Program Flow Analysis: Theory and
Applications . Prentice Hall, Englewood Clis, New Jersey, 1981.
37. F. Nielson. A bibliography on abstract interpretations. ACM SIGPLAN Notices ,
21:31 { 38, 1986.
38. J. Palsberg and M. I. Schwartzbach. Object-oriented Type Systems . John Wiley &
Sons, 1994.
39. Jens Palsberg. Type inference for objects. ACM Computing Surveys , 28(2):358{
359, June 1996.
40. O. Ruthing. Bidirectional data flow analysis in code motion: Myth and reality. In
Proceedings of the 5th Static Analysis Symposium ( SAS'98 )( Pisa, Italy ), Lecture
Notes in Computer Science, vol. 1503, pages 1 { 16. Springer-Verlag, Heidelberg,
Germany, 1998.
41. O. Ruthing. Interacting Code Motion Transformations: Their Impact and Their
Complexity. PhD thesis. University of Kiel, Germany, 1997 . Lecture Notes in
Computer Science, vol. 1539, Springer-Verlag, Heidelberg, Germany, 1998.
42. O. Ruthing. Optimal code motion in the presence of large expressions. In Proceed-
ings of the 6th IEEE Computer Society 1998 International Conference on Com-
puter Languages ( ICCL'98 )( Chicago, Illinois ), pages 216 { 225. IEEE Computer
Society, Los Alamitos, 1998.
43. O. Ruthing, J. Knoop, and B. Steen. Sparse code motion. Technical Report
712/1999, Department of Computer Science, University of Dortmund, Germany,
1999.
44. M. Sharir and A. Pnueli. Two approaches to interprocedural data flow analysis.
In S. S. Muchnick and N. D. Jones, editors, Program Flow Analysis: Theory and
Applications , chapter 7, pages 189 { 233. Prentice Hall, Englewood Clis, New
Jersey, 1981.
45. VFCS/VFC Homepage. Institute for Softwaretechnology and Parallel Sys-
tems, University of Vienna, Austria, http://www.par.univie.ac.at/research/lang-
comp/lang-comp.html.
Search WWH ::




Custom Search